Shown below is a Decircuit that contains two switches. The resistance of each switch is a negligible when closed. All of the connecting wires should be considered to have zero resistance. All of the resistors shown are identical. The circuit contains an ideal ammeter and an ideal voltmeter. The diagram shows the switches open. Beside the diagram are four different switch configurations for the circuit. Rank these configurations from largest to smallest in terms of the voltmeter reading. Rank these configurations from largest to smallest in terms of the ammeter reading

Solution

For the voltmeter reading

When S1 is closed the voltmeter reads zero hence for C and D , V = 0

Now when S1 is open the voltage drop can be written as

in case A

v = V0/4

in case B

v = Vo/2

Hence the order will be

B > A > C = D

Now The ammeter readings will depend on net resistance in all the cases so let\'s see

Case A

I = V/4R

Case B

I = V/2R

Case C

I = V/3.5R

Case D

I = V/1.5R

Hence

D > B >C > A
